I'm currently splitting my time between two things: as an Infrastructure Engineer at Cyphers, I own deployments, RPC/indexing infrastructure, and the CI/CD and monitoring stack for a privacy-preserving prediction market protocol built on Solana. As a Software Engineer at AudoraLabs, I build Auro, an all-in-one business workspace for freelancers and teams, working across Next.js, TypeScript, PostgreSQL, and AWS.

Before that, I spent a year as a freelance full-stack engineer, delivering 10+ production applications across healthcare, hospitality, and SaaS for 8,000+ users, and providing architecture guidance to 6 early-stage startups through Rajasthan's iStart government program. Earlier still, I worked as a DevOps engineer building Terraform-provisioned AWS infrastructure and CI/CD pipelines with GitHub Actions.

I hold a Master of Computer Applications with a specialization in Cloud Computing & DevOps from Chandigarh University. Outside of client and employer work, I build Autopsy, a Solana transaction forensics engine, and contribute to open source Solana tooling.
